This state has issued the following list of items that cannot be sold as a form of taxidermy: Leopard, Snow Leopard, Clouded Leopard, Tiger, Asiatic Lion, Cheetah, Alligators, Caiman or Crocodile, tortoises of the genus Gopherus, marine turtles of the family Cheloniidae and the family Dermochelidae, Vicuna, Wolf, Red Wolf, or Kangaroo or Polar Bear, Mountain Lion, sometimes called Cougar, Jaguar, Ocelot, or Margay, Sumatran Rhinoceros, or Black Rhinoceros. Fish and Wildlife's Lacey Act (18 U.S.C. 703-712) implements four international conservation treaties that the U.S. entered into with Canada in 1916, Mexico in 1936, Japan in 1972, and Russia in 1976.It is intended to ensure the sustainability of populations of all protected migratory bird species. Effective on January 1, 2020, California Penal Code Section 653o will make it illegal to import into California for commercial purposes, to possess with intent to sell, or to sell within the state, the dead body, or any part or product thereof, of a crocodile or alligator. To prevent the accidental importation of CWD-infected tissues into the state,California Code of Regulations Title 14, section 712prohibits hunters from importing or possessing carcasses with a skull or backbone still attached. (A) Any person may possess all or any part of a cervidae carcass legally taken, killed or processed in Ohio, unless the carcass is taken from an area of Ohio designated as a disease surveillance area as provided for in rule 1501:31-19-03 of the Administrative Code and that is posted on the division website at wildohio.gov. Subject to federal regulations, legally obtained feathers, squirrel pelts, rabbit pelts, groundhog pelts, turkey bones, turkey heads and deer heads, antlers, hides or feet may be bought, sold or bartered when accompanied by a bill of sale showing the sellers full name, address and the number and species of these parts, and the full name and address of the purchaser. 1.
